Each review score is between 1-10. To get the overall score that you see, we add up all the review scores we’ve received and divide that total by the number of review scores we’ve received. We are currently testing a weighted review system in Malta, Iceland, Australia, Greece, Brazil and North Carolina. For properties in these regions, the more recent the review, the bigger the impact on the total review score calculation. In addition, guests can give separate ‘subscores’ in crucial areas, such as location, cleanliness, staff, comfort, facilities, value for money and free Wi-Fi. Note that guests submit their subscores and their overall scores independently, so there’s no direct link between them.

West Cottage is a beautiful property set in the heart of Cromer. The town centre is just a few steps away. Spacious accommodation with an extra large, well-equipped kitchen. Good sized bedrooms, one with en-suite. Nice-sized lounge and 2 x other side rooms plus a large dining room. Very clean bed linen and towels. One en-suite, one bathroom upstairs and one toilet on ground floor. As advertised, the stairs ARE very steep and need careful negotiation especially if elderly or when carrying bags. Top bedrooms are accessible via 2 lots of stairs (the twin bedroom is accessed via entering the staircase "inside" the master bedroom). Our group of ladies had a fabulous time at West Cottage and Sophie was very obliging with great communications. We loved our stay!
